@mariesvandefliert8533 5 жыл бұрын
Maybe a stupid question. But i am new in this world. Does this do the same thing as using storage mode on my charger?
@AMain_Hobbies
@AMain_Hobbies 5 жыл бұрын
Yes and No. Storage Mode will restore cell voltage to a safe level for storage. So, Storage Mode will either discharge, or charge the battery, depending on if your battery voltage is too high, or too low. A discharger will only discharge. Hope that makes sense. The dischargers shown in this video discharge must faster than most chargers can do it, so that is their advantage. -Brett

@thomaswalton9089 5 ай бұрын
Is discharge and storage charge the same thing? I dont understand lipos lol. If i fully charged my battery and dont use it should i discharge it or storage charge
@AMain_Hobbies
@AMain_Hobbies 5 ай бұрын
Good question. The discharge mode will discharge your battery down, draining the power until the desired voltage has been reached. With the storage mode, the charger will either charge or discharge the battery (which ever is needed) until the battery has reached the desired voltage. So with the storage mode, you can put on a fully charged battery or a drained battery, and the charger will know what it needs to do to return the battery to it's optimal state for inactivity, when you store it away. LiPo batteries like to have about 50% power when they're sitting around unused, and the storage mode makes it happen. I can't remember the last time I used the discharge feature on the charger instead of just using the storage mode for the same job. The discharge feature is more useful with other battery chemistries (non-lipo) but it's still there as an option. Hope this makes sense. -Brett

@scottmcgrath5547
@scottmcgrath5547 5 жыл бұрын
so can you discharge at any Rate you want and it wont affect the lipo or do you need to keep it under a certain current depending on the C Rating of the Battery
@AMain_Hobbies
@AMain_Hobbies 5 жыл бұрын
Any rate Scott. Few discharge devices will ever draw the same power out of your LiPo like a Brushless R/C car pulling 100A, 160A and up, at peak draw. With the C rating, again, all dischargers will be way lower than the real capabilities of the battery, so I wouldn't worry about it. The exception are the tiny receiver/transmitter LiPo batteries, they shouldn't be discharged at high amps. -Brett
